Double Chocolate Chip Muffins

Double Chocolate Chip Muffins are a delightful and indulgent treat for chocolate lovers. Here’s a simple recipe for you to enjoy:

Ingredients:

  • 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ips (plus extra for topping)

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the Oven:
    •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a muffin tin with paper liners or grease the cups.
  2. Mix Dry Ingredients:
    • In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
  3. Combine Wet Ingredients:
    • In another b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la extract until well combined.
  4.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ients:
    •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ir until just combined. Do not overmix; a few lumps are okay.
  5. Add Chocolate Chips:
    • Gently fold in the chocolate chips into the batter.
  6. Fill Muffin Cups:
    •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in cups, filling each about 2/3 full.
  7. Add Extra Chocolate Chips:
    • Sprinkle additional chocolate chips on top of each muffin for extra chocolate goodness.
  8. Bake:
    • Bake in the preheated oven for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
  9. Cool:
    • Allow the muffins to cool in the tin for a few minutes, then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
  10. Serve:
    • Once cooled, these Double Chocolate Chip Muffins are ready to be enjoyed.

These muffins are perfect for breakfast, brunch, or as a sweet snack. The combination of cocoa powder and chocolate chips creates a rich and moist texture. Feel free to customize the recipe by adding nuts or different types of chocolate chips if desired.
